Job description
The UI/UX Designer plays a crucial role in creating intuitive, visually appealing, and user-friendly digital products and interfaces. This role involves a combination of design and user research skills to ensure that products meet the needs and expectations of users while aligning with the business objectives of the company. UI/UX Designers work closely with cross-functional teams, including product managers, developers, and stakeholders, to deliver exceptional user interfaces and experiences., * Create user-centered designs by considering market & competitive analysis, customer feedback, and usability findings.
- Lead and define specifications for our products user interface and experience, ensuring that content and functionality are logically organized and intuitive for our users.
- Conduct concept and usability testing; gather and evaluate user feedback.
- Develop wireframes and prototypes that outline the layout and functionality of digital interfaces, allowing for early testing, feedback and refinement of solutions.
- Collaborate with product, editorial, marketing, and engineering in an agile process.
- Ensure that digital products are accessible to all users, including those with disabilities, by adhering to accessibility standards and guidelines.
- Design interfaces that are responsive and adaptable to different screen sizes and devices.
- Keep up to date on industry trends, establish and advocate for UX/UI best practices, guidelines and standards, and emerging technologies; contribute to improvements in design systems, process, and workflow.
- Collaborate with other designers to maintain design consistency and coherence across the product as appropriate.
- Support development, QA, and launch of products and feature iterations.
